What is the use of curtain?
Atmospheric protection:
One of the uses of the window is natural light, and this light is directly related to the temperature of the room, and the absence of curtains can make the temperature of the house hot or cold, so here it is necessary to use curtains to adjust the amount of heat and cold. We can change it according to our wish and about 30% of the temperature regulation is done by using the front window and the curtain contributes to 20% of it, so every structure needs a suitable curtain with a suitable measurement in addition to the window to protect it from atmospheric factors.
